Monza future still in doubt after Ecclestone meeting

Efforts to secure and put the future of the Italian Grand Prix back on track appear to have faltered. With Bernie Ecclestone warning that his axe is hanging above historic Monza, Italian automobile club president Angelo Sticchi-Damiani and official Ivan Capelli, representing the promoter Sias, met on Friday with the F1 supremo in Monaco. Corriere della Sera, a Milan-published daily, said the meeting resulted in stalemate. Organisers of the Italian grand prix are reportedly 20 million short in their struggle to remain on an ever-expanding F1 calendar that is increasingly moving away from Europe and into more lucrative markets such as Mexico and Azerbaijan.
